Transaction 528cc658b49cb6b4d9efe58d1466e6867a847475ee37afc2eae3e2647f227828

1 Input
2 Outputs
  • 528cc658b49cb6b4d9efe58d1466e6867a847475ee37afc2eae3e2647f227828:0
  • value  4000000
    address  3KefcK7s1rHxTNH7Gi9GisGg2uTuFkJWUK
  • 528cc658b49cb6b4d9efe58d1466e6867a847475ee37afc2eae3e2647f227828:1
  • value  5385048
    address  3MUmb2bn5pPXHG3WyQnyHZm8m5b9YARGyd